What are the roles of CNAs? 

Before proceeding to describe the hiring process, it is important to understand the day-to-day work of CNAs. They support patients with activities of daily living (ADLs) such as bathing, dressing, and eating. They also assist them with basic medical tasks, monitor patient health, and provide emotional support. Given the nature of their work that requires care and attention, hiring competent and compassionate CNAs is crucial.

Steps to hire CNA in the USA 

Step 1: Define your needs

The primary step in hiring a CNA is to define your requirements precisely. This includes the exact job they will perform, how many CNAs you are looking to hire, working hours, and the benefits your healthcare facility will provide (for permanent role) or pay rates you are willing to offer (for contract roles). If job seekers have a clear idea of the job role, they will be more interested in applying.

Step 2: Create a job description

A defined and well-written description is important for attracting qualified candidates to hire, the job descriptions must include: 

  • Job title
  • Duties and responsibilities
  • Qualifications
  • Skills
  • Work hours

Job descriptions play an important role when looking for CNAs; they give a clear picture of the job to job seekers. So, always write clear information about “What are you looking for” while crafting the job description to hire CNA.

Step 5: Conduct interviews

The interview process is crucial for assessing a candidate’s suitability for the role. Here are some tips for conducting effective interviews to hire CNA:

  • Prepare questions: Ask about their previous experience, why they chose to become a CNA, and how they handle stressful situations.
  • Assess soft skills: Evaluate their communication skills, empathy, and ability to work in a team.
  • Scenario-based questions: Present hypothetical situations to understand how they would respond in real-life scenarios.

Step 8: Onboarding and training

Once you’ve selected the right candidates to hire CNA, the onboarding process begins. This includes:

  • Orientation: Introduce them to your facility, policies, and procedures.
  • Training: Provide any necessary training specific to your facility, including safety protocols and patient care techniques.
  • Mentorship: Pair new hires with experienced staff for guidance and support during the initial period.

Step 9: Offer competitive pay and benefits

Offering competitive pay and benefits is crucial to attracting and retaining CNAs. According to a study by Glassdoor, the CNA salary in the USA is $41391. Providing benefits such as health insurance, paid time off, and opportunities for career advancement can make your job offer more attractive.
